Brown-out Detection

ATmega16 has an On-chip Brown-out Detection (BOD) circuit for monitoring the V

CC

level during operation by comparing it to a fixed trigger level. The trigger level for the
BOD can be selected by the fuse BODLEVEL to be 2.7V (BODLEVEL unprogrammed),
or 4.0V (BODLEVEL programmed). The trigger level has a hysteresis to ensure spike
free Brown-out Detection. The hysteresis on the detection level should be interpreted as
V

BOT+

= V

BOT

+ V

HYST

/2 and V

BOT-

= V

BOT

- V

HYST

/2.

The BOD circuit can be enabled/disabled by the fuse BODEN. When the BOD is
enabled (BODEN programmed), and V

CC

decreases to a value below the trigger level

(V

BOT-

in Figure 19), the Brown-out Reset is immediately activated. When V

CC

increases

above the trigger level (V

BOT+

in Figure 19), the delay counter starts the MCU after the

time-out period t

TOUT

has expired.

The BOD circuit will only detect a drop in V

CC

if the voltage stays below the trigger level

for longer than t

BOD

given in Table 15.
